import ebooklib
import ftfy.bad_codecs
import json
import os
import re
import zipfile
from bs4 import BeautifulSoup
from ebooklib import epub
from mobi import Mobi
from pdfminer.high_level import extract_text
ROAM_DIR_PATH = r"C:\Users\Cooper\Documents\07_Misc_Notes\Roam_exports"
ROAM_LATEST_EXPORT_PATH = ""
HOME_PATH = os.getcwd()
# define functions that take a document and produce
# the full text with metadata.
def read_pdf(filepath):
try:
full_text = extract_text(filepath)
except:
full_text = ""
doc = {
'filepath' : filepath,
'full_text' : full_text,
'title' : filepath,
'author' : "",
}
return doc
def read_epub(filepath):
blacklist = [
'[document]',
'noscript',
'header',
'html',
'meta',
'head',
'input',
'script',
]
book = epub.read_epub(filepath)
# Get metadata regardless of the namespace,
# which for EPUBs can be 'DC' or 'OPF'
def find_by_key(data, target):
for key, value in data.items():
if isinstance(value, dict):
yield from find_by_key(value, target)
elif key == target:
yield value
# get EPUB content as HTML chapters
def epub2thtml(book):
chapters = []
for item in book.get_items():
if item.get_type() == ebooklib.ITEM_DOCUMENT:
chapters.append(item.get_content())
return chapters
# get HTML chapter as text
def chap2text(chap):
output = ''
soup = BeautifulSoup(chap, 'html.parser')
text = soup.find_all(text=True)
for t in text:
if t.parent.name not in blacklist:
output += '{0} '.format(t)
return output
# parse all html chapters
def thtml2ttext(thtml):
output = []
for html in thtml:
text = chap2text(html)
output.append(text)
return "".join(output)
# return full text
def epub2text(book):
chapters = epub2thtml(book)
ttext = thtml2ttext(chapters)
return ttext
full_text = epub2text(book)
title = next(find_by_key(book.metadata, 'title'))
author = next(find_by_key(book.metadata, 'creator'))
# get the string values out of lists or tuples
while isinstance(title, list) or isinstance(title, tuple):
title = title[0]
while isinstance(author, list) or isinstance(author, tuple):
author = author[0]
doc = {
'filepath' : filepath,
'full_text' : full_text,
'title' : title,
'author' : author,
}
return doc
def read_mobi(filepath):
book = Mobi(filepath)
book.parse()
records = []
for record in book:
records.append(record)
full_text = ' '.join(records)
title = book.title().decode('utf-8')
author = book.author().decode('utf-8')
doc = {
'filepath' : filepath,
'full_text' : full_text,
'title' : title,
'author' : author,
}
return doc
